Once the public important continues to be configured within the server, the server will permit any connecting person which includes the non-public vital to log in. In the login process, the customer proves possession of your personal essential by digitally signing The important thing Trade.
How then should I down load my non-public essential. With this tutorial, there isn't any in which you stated about downloading the personal important to my machine. Which file should really I the obtain to utilize on PuTTy?
The final piece of the puzzle is controlling passwords. It could possibly get incredibly laborous coming into a password anytime you initialize an SSH relationship. To receive all over this, we could use the password administration program that comes along with macOS and various Linux distributions.
Take note that even though OpenSSH ought to get the job done for An array of Linux distributions, this tutorial has long been tested applying Ubuntu.
The central thought is always that rather than a password, just one employs a important file that is definitely nearly unattainable to guess. You give the public section of one's key, and when logging in, it will be employed, together with the private essential and username, to validate your identification.
Warning: When you have Beforehand produced a important pair, you may be prompted to substantiate that you really want to overwrite the present crucial:
In the event you drop your personal important, get rid of its corresponding community essential from the server's authorized_keys file and develop a new vital pair. It is usually recommended to save lots of the SSH keys in a secret administration Software.
They are a more secure way to attach than passwords. We show you how to deliver, set up, and use SSH keys in Linux.
While you are prompted to "Enter a file through which to save lots of The true secret," push Enter to accept the default file area.
Basically all cybersecurity regulatory frameworks involve taking care of who can access what. SSH keys grant obtain, and drop less than this necessity. This, organizations underneath compliance mandates are needed to employ appropriate administration processes with the keys. NIST IR 7966 is a great starting point.
Our createssh suggestion is that these types of gadgets must have a components random range generator. If your CPU does not have one particular, it should be crafted on to the motherboard. The fee is rather compact.
Right after getting into your password, the information of your respective id_rsa.pub essential are going to be copied to the end in the authorized_keys file of the remote user’s account. Continue on to the next section if this was thriving.
If you don't want a passphrase and develop the keys without having a passphrase prompt, You should use the flag -q -N as proven underneath.
When creating SSH keys under Linux, You need to use the ssh-keygen command. It's a tool for developing new authentication crucial pairs for SSH.